Delayed
ejaculation
A sexual dysfunction in which
a man has difficulty ejaculating during
intercourse.
Dental
dam
A latex shield placed
over the vulva or anus that blocks the exchange of bodily fluids
therefore reducing the chance of contracting
STDs.
Desensitization
A technique
used by sex therapists to help patients overcome fears and
phobias.
Detumescence
When an erect
penis becomes flaccid again after orgasm.
Deviant Sexual
Behavior
Sexual behavior that
strays from the norm.
Diaphragm
A saucer-shaped
rubber contraceptive device that is filled with spermicide and
inserted into the back of the vagina to block the cervical
opening. Most common barrier method for women.
Dildo
A device used for sexual
stimulation by insertion into the vagina or anus that is usually
in the overall shape of a phallus.

Douche
To flush out the
inside of the vagina with a cleansing fluid. This practice is
usually unnecessary and can actually upset the natural ph and
floral balance of the vagina therefore increasing chance for
infection.

Dysmenorrhea
Painful
menstruation.
Dyspareunia
Painful
intercourse.
